    WHats happened to the US NO of boosting income at war?  And what are the new starting incomes?  Are they the same?

    If the US doesnt get its extra IPC’s, isnt it a huge nerf to the allies?

    Also,  If german naval units are moving into the channel, and germany attacks uk navy, can planes scramble to assist from uk?

    The US still gets boosted income - it’s just spread out a bit to make it easier for the Axis to disrupt.

    1. Collect 10 IPCs per turn for complete control of the continental US (WUS, CUS, EUS). Theme: Basic national sovereignty.
    2. Collect 5 IPC per turn if the Allies control 5 of the 7 following islands. Midway, Wake, Marianas, Iwo Jima, Caroline, Solomon Islands and Guam. Theme: Islands considered to be vital strategic forward bases.
    3. Collect 5 IPCs per turn for controlling the Philippines. Theme: Center of American influence in Asia.
    4. Collect 5 IPCs per turn for controlling Hawaii, Alaska, the Aleutian Islands, Line Islands, and Johnston Island. Theme National sovereignty issues.
    5. Collect 5 IPCs per turn for controlling, Mexico, Southern Mexico, Central America (Panama) and the West indies. Theme: Defense treaty & trade obligations.

    It’s not a nerf, considering the US still gets the full 30 IPCs.  It makes the game a bit easier for the axis (compared to OOB, which was unbalanced towards the allies).

    And yes, UK planes can scramble to assist a naval battle in the channel.
